How Target CPA Works
Google changes bids auction by auction based on predicted conversion likelihood. Individual conversions can cost more or less than the target; the strategy aims toward the target as an average over time. Google updated the visible strategy labels in 2026, but the underlying behavior remains the same.
A Simple Example
With a $75 Target CPA, one lead might cost $40 and another $110 while the campaign works toward an average near $75.
Why Target CPA Matters
Target CPA provides a clear efficiency control for campaigns where conversions have reasonably similar business value.
Common Misreading
A target that is much stricter than recent performance can restrict traffic and conversion volume. The target is a steering input, not a guaranteed price for every acquisition.
